Satellite layer
VIIRS and MODIS can detect heat over a large area. A point is a lead for verification, not a replacement for firefighters assessing conditions on the ground.
Wind and fire danger
Wind direction and fire danger add context. A downwind projection is informational and is not an evacuation forecast.
Aircraft and roads
Public aircraft positions and road events may improve situational awareness but can be delayed or incomplete. Each layer therefore has its own freshness label.
